Herbie Hide Continues Cruiserweight Campaign

Filed under: Amateur Sports, Athletes, Boxing, Exercise Fitness, Extreme Sports, Sports — Lisa @ 1:03 pm

Former Two Time Heavyweight World Champion Herbie Hide announces today that his comeback as a Cruiserweight is on a fast track as he is scheduled to fight again, less than a month and half from his last fight and one round destruction of Mitch Hicks. This time it will be against Jesse Corona (6-16) on November 4, 2006 at the Mid West Event in Oklahoma City, Oklahoma.

The Best Style of Martial Arts Is?

Filed under: Articles about Sports, Exercise Fitness, Martial Arts, News and Views, Sports — 19cyberposter @ 11:42 am

The best martial art for self defense is the one that you can make work when actually faced with a situation. You have to believe in the style that you train. If you don’t believe that your style would actually work in a real life situation, then it won’t. If you train a style that isn’t suited for your body type, you may have trouble applying it when you need it. Listen to your body when training martial arts, but also listen to your mind. If you don’t believe in your style, your training is useless. Even if you train the “wrong” style for your body, your belief in yourself and your style will help you prevail.

The importance of proper aerobic shoes is often underrated. People talk about doing the exercises right, planning out a routine, eating properly, hydrating properly, and all manner of other workout tips, but they seldom get to talk about good gym shoes. Of course, if you are taking an aerobics class, then footwear does not matter. You will do all of your aerobic exercise on a padded mat, and wearing shoes will be discouraged, if not outright banned from the room for the sake of preserving the floor. But for many other aerobic exercises (with swimming and a few other excepted) proper aerobic shoes are a must. You just can not protect your feet without them.
